Hindustan Times: New York, A collection of over 20 paintings by legendary artist M F Husain fetched $4.7 million at auctions held at the prestigious Christie's and Sotheby's in New York. An auction held today at Sotheby's of 11 masterpieces by late Husain fetched a total of $557,500 with one of his paintings 'Man with Sitar' selling for $146,500. However, proceeds from the Sotheby's auction paled in comparison to those generated at Christie's two days ago, where a single Husain work was sold for $1.14 million. At the Christie's sale, 'Sprinkling Horses' went under the hammer for $1.14 million, one of the highest amounts ever paid for the late master's work. It was among the 13 paintings that were auctioned at Christie's sale of South Asian modern and contemporary art. The 13 paintings were sold for a total of $4.2 million. Eleven Husain paintings were on sale at Sotheby's, which presented Modern and Contemporary South Asian Art including Indian Miniature Paintings as part of its week of Asian art auctions.
